The Prusa i3 is a popular 3D printer model that offers quality parts, ease of use, and excellent support. However, Prusa printers can be expensive, and there are valid reasons why you may want to consider a Prusa alternative . One such alternative is the MatterHackers Pulse, which is based on the open-source Prusa i3 design, tuned to perfection for smooth, out-of-the-box printing, and pieced together with quality components throughout. The Pulse looks, behaves, and feels like an i3 but costs $200 less than the pre-assembled i3 MK3S+
